House Demolition Service in Pearland, TX
House demolition services involve the complete or partial removal of residential structures, often to clear the way for new construction, renovations, or property development. These projects can range from demolishing an entire house to removing specific sections like garages, additions, or outbuildings. Homeowners typically seek this service when planning major upgrades, dealing with unsafe or outdated structures, or preparing a property for sale. It’s important for property owners to understand the scope of demolition, site cleanup requirements, and potential permits or regulations that may apply before requesting a service.
Before initiating a house demolition, property owners should consider factors such as the size and type of the structure, access to the site, and the presence of any hazardous materials like asbestos or lead paint. Clarifying the desired outcome-whether complete removal or partial demolition-and understanding the necessary steps for site preparation can help ensure a smooth process. Additionally, knowing about any local regulations or permits required for demolition projects in Pearland, TX, can help property owners plan accordingly and avoid potential delays.

Common House Demolition Service Jobs
House Demolition - complete removal of an entire residential structure for rebuilding or renovation projects.
Garage Demolition - safe teardown of garages to create space for new construction or landscaping.
Interior Demolition - removal of interior walls, flooring, or fixtures to update or remodel living spaces.
Foundation Demolition - tearing down old or damaged foundations to prepare for new construction.
Partial Demolition - selective removal of specific sections of a home for upgrades or expansions.
Mobile Home Demolition - dismantling of manufactured homes to clear land or repurpose property.
House Demolition Service Questions
What types of structures can be demolished? House demolition services typically handle residential buildings, garages, sheds, and other small to medium structures on a property.
Is a permit required for house demolition? Yes, demolition projects usually require permits from local authorities to ensure compliance with regulations.
What should property owners consider before demolition? It's important to evaluate the presence of utilities, obtain necessary permissions, and plan for debris removal and site cleanup.
How is debris managed after demolition? Debris is usually sorted and removed from the site, with options for recycling or disposal according to local guidelines.
